DragSourceContext Класс
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Предоставляет данные источника перетаскивания, которые изначально задаются при создании ElementGroupPrototype на источнике. Он используется для обратной связи и процесса слияния (т. е. с помощью перетаскивания).
public ref class DragSourceContext
[System.Serializable]
public class DragSourceContext
[<System.Serializable>]
type DragSourceContext = class
Public Class DragSourceContext
- Наследование
-
DragSourceContext
- Атрибуты
Методы
| GetDiagramId(ElementGroup) |
Возвращает идентификатор исходной схемы. Это может вернуть GUID. Empty, если не был указан идентификатор схемы или нет доступного контекста перетаскивания. |
| GetDiagramId(ElementGroupPrototype) |
Возвращает идентификатор исходной схемы. Это может вернуть GUID. Empty, если не был указан идентификатор схемы или нет доступного контекста перетаскивания. |
| GetGhostShapes(ElementGroup) |
Получает исходную коллекцию фантомных фигур. |
| GetGhostShapes(ElementGroupPrototype) |
Получает исходную коллекцию фантомных фигур. |
| GetInitialBoundingBox(ElementGroup) |
Возвращает ограничивающий прямоугольник (в абсолютных мировых координатах), охватывающий все фигуры. |
| GetInitialBoundingBox(ElementGroupPrototype) |
Возвращает ограничивающий прямоугольник (в абсолютных мировых координатах), охватывающий все фигуры. |
| GetInitialDragLocation(ElementGroup) |
Возвращает положение мыши в абсолютных мировых координатах при начале перетаскивания. |
| GetInitialDragLocation(ElementGroupPrototype) |
Возвращает положение мыши в абсолютных мировых координатах при начале перетаскивания. |
| GetInitialPrimaryShapeBounds(ElementGroup) |
Возвращает границы (в абсолютных мировых координатах) первичной фигуры в ElementGroupPrototype. |
| GetInitialPrimaryShapeBounds(ElementGroupPrototype) |
Возвращает границы (в абсолютных мировых координатах) первичной фигуры в ElementGroupPrototype. |
| GetInitialPrimaryShapeId(ElementGroup) |
Возвращает идентификатор Guid первичной фигуры в ElementGroupPototype. |
| GetInitialPrimaryShapeId(ElementGroupPrototype) |
Возвращает идентификатор Guid первичной фигуры в ElementGroupPototype. |
| GetProcessId(ElementGroup) |
Возвращает идентификатор исходного процесса. Это может вернуть значение 0, если идентификатор процесса не был указан, или если контекст источника перетаскивания недоступен. |
| GetProcessId(ElementGroupPrototype) |
Возвращает идентификатор исходного процесса. Это может вернуть значение 0, если идентификатор процесса не был указан, или если контекст источника перетаскивания недоступен. |
| GetStoreId(ElementGroup) |
Возвращает идентификатор исходного хранилища. Это может вернуть GUID. Empty, если не был указан идентификатор хранилища или нет доступного контекста перетаскивания. |
| GetStoreId(ElementGroupPrototype) |
Возвращает идентификатор исходного хранилища. Это может вернуть GUID. Empty, если не был указан идентификатор хранилища или нет доступного контекста перетаскивания. |
| Set(ElementGroupPrototype, PointD, GhostShapeCollection) |
Добавляет сведения об источнике перетаскивания в контекст источника ElementGroupPrototype. |